Understanding What a 100 amp hour battery Is
Have you ever wondered what the term 100 amp hour battery means? Let’s break it down. AGM stands for Absorbent Glass Mat, a type of lead-acid battery characterized by its ability to endure high-capacity storage and repeated deep-discharge operations.
A 100 amp hour battery won’t disappoint when it comes to power delivery. It can maintain a stable output of 5 amps for 20 hours before the voltage drops to 10.5 volts. Its impressive lifespan is 4 to 7 years, although this can vary depending on its usage and how well you maintain it.

Determining the Right Placement
Setting up the perfect spot for your 100 Amp Hour AGM Deep Cycle Battery is the first step towards a successful installation. You’re looking for a dry, clean, and ventilated area.
Why? It ensures your battery doesn’t succumb to moisture or excessive heat, which can degrade its performance over time. Proximity to the appliances the battery will power is essential, but keep a safe distance to prevent heat transfer.

Making Connections and Charging
With the perfect spot for your 100 Amp Hour AGM Deep Cycle Battery secured, it’s time to connect the dots. Start by hooking the positive (usually red) battery cable to the positive battery terminal. Next, connect the negative (usually black) cable to the negative terminal. Take your wrench and tighten the connections until they’re snug – but remember to do it sparingly!
Loose connections can lead to inconsistent power output, but overtightening could damage the terminal. Next on the agenda is charging your battery. Before harnessing its power for your appliances, could you give it a thorough first-time charge?

Maximizing Your 100 amp AGM battery Lifespan
A battery’s longevity isn’t simply a matter of chance. It is influenced by how you use it and care for it. Keeping your 100 amp AGM battery constantly juiced up significantly increases its lifespan. Charging it even before it runs completely low helps maintain its efficiency.
A moderate environment is also a key factor for battery health. Extreme temperatures can negatively impact performance, so keep the battery in a location with stable, moderate temperatures. Regular cleaning of battery terminals is another maintenance tip that must be considered. Dust and grime buildup can affect power transfer, hampering the battery’s efficiency.
